Understanding the Components of Blood
To grasp the different types of blood disorders, it is helpful to understand the basic components of healthy blood. Blood is comprised of several elements suspended in a liquid called plasma.
- Red Blood Cells (RBCs): Responsible for carrying oxygen from the lungs to the rest of the body. Hemoglobin, an iron-rich protein, is essential for this function.
- White Blood Cells (WBCs): These are vital components of the immune system, helping the body fight off infections and diseases.
- Platelets: Tiny, irregular-shaped cells that are crucial for blood clotting to stop bleeding.
When any of these components are affected, either in their quantity or function, a blood disorder can arise.
The Three Main Categories of Blood Disorders
Blood disorders are broadly categorized by which of the blood's components are primarily affected. The three main groups are red blood cell disorders, white blood cell disorders, and platelet and clotting disorders.
1. Red Blood Cell Disorders
These conditions involve issues with red blood cells, their production, or their function.
Types of Red Blood Cell Disorders
- Anemia: The most common blood disorder, characterized by a lack of healthy red blood cells or insufficient hemoglobin. There are many types, including:
- Iron-deficiency anemia: Caused by low iron levels.
- Sickle cell disease: An inherited disorder causing red blood cells to become misshapen, blocking blood flow.
- Thalassemia: A genetic disorder where the body produces less hemoglobin.
- Polycythemia Vera: A type of blood cancer where the bone marrow makes too many red blood cells, thickening the blood and increasing the risk of clots.
Symptoms of Red Blood Cell Disorders
Common symptoms often include fatigue, weakness, shortness of breath, headaches, and a pale appearance.
2. White Blood Cell Disorders
This category includes conditions affecting the body's white blood cells and the immune system.
Types of White Blood Cell Disorders
- Leukemia: A blood cancer where the bone marrow produces abnormal white blood cells that crowd out healthy cells.
- Lymphoma: A cancer originating in the immune system, often in the lymph nodes, that involves a different type of white blood cell.
- Leukopenia: A condition with abnormally low white blood cell counts, which can increase susceptibility to infections.
- Leukocytosis: A condition with an unusually high white blood cell count, which can occur due to infection or inflammation.
Symptoms of White Blood Cell Disorders
Symptoms can range from recurrent infections, fever, and night sweats to swollen lymph nodes.
3. Platelet and Clotting Disorders
These conditions affect platelets or other clotting factors, leading to either excessive bleeding or dangerous blood clots.
Types of Platelet and Clotting Disorders
- Hemophilia: A group of inherited disorders where the blood lacks specific clotting factors, causing prolonged bleeding.
- von Willebrand Disease: The most common inherited bleeding disorder, caused by a deficiency in von Willebrand factor, a clotting protein.
- Thrombocytopenia: A condition with an abnormally low platelet count, leading to easier bruising and bleeding.
- Thrombosis: The formation of blood clots in a blood vessel, which can be life-threatening.
Symptoms of Platelet and Clotting Disorders
Easy or excessive bruising, frequent nosebleeds, and heavy menstrual bleeding are common. More severe issues include internal bleeding and chest pain from clots.
Comparison of Blood Disorder Categories
Feature | Red Blood Cell Disorders | White Blood Cell Disorders | Platelet & Clotting Disorders |
---|---|---|---|
Primary Function Affected | Oxygen Transport | Immune Response | Blood Clotting |
Key Examples | Anemia, Thalassemia, Polycythemia Vera | Leukemia, Lymphoma, Leukopenia | Hemophilia, Thrombocytopenia, Thrombosis |
Common Symptoms | Fatigue, weakness, pale skin, shortness of breath | Recurrent infections, fever, swollen lymph nodes | Easy bruising, bleeding gums, prolonged bleeding |
Cause | Nutritional deficiencies, genetics, chronic disease | Genetic mutations, environmental factors, immune system issues | Genetics, autoimmune conditions, certain medications |
Diagnosis and Treatment Options
Diagnosing a blood disorder typically involves a combination of a medical exam, a complete blood count (CBC), and specialized tests like bone marrow biopsies. Treatment strategies vary greatly depending on the specific disorder and its severity.
General Treatment Approaches
- Medication: This can include iron supplements for anemia, chemotherapy for blood cancers, or anticoagulants for clotting disorders.
- Transfusions: For severe anemias or bleeding disorders, blood or platelet transfusions may be necessary to replenish blood components.
- Stem Cell Transplant: Used for more severe conditions like aplastic anemia or leukemia, where a patient's diseased bone marrow is replaced with healthy stem cells.
- Lifestyle Adjustments: Maintaining a balanced diet rich in essential nutrients like iron and B12 is crucial for supporting blood health.

Promoting Blood Health
While some blood disorders are inherited and unavoidable, several lifestyle choices can support overall blood health and potentially mitigate the effects of some conditions.
- Balanced Diet: Ensure your diet includes iron-rich foods (lean meat, spinach), B12 and folate (eggs, leafy greens), and Vitamin C (citrus fruits) to support healthy blood cell production.
- Regular Exercise: Physical activity improves circulation and cardiovascular health. For those with bleeding disorders, low-impact exercise is often recommended.
- Hydration: Staying well-hydrated is crucial for maintaining healthy blood volume and circulation.
